Mike Haines

Great little hidden gem filled with good ol' regulars and newbies stopping in for a cold one. It is beer only but they're always cold. They don't have food but there's usually a table with free snacks for the taking. Carolyn, Kathy and Kelly are always happy to see ya and serve up a smile and a beer. Don't let the outside fool you, stop and see for yourself. Tell them Mustache Mike sent you!

Vegetarian options: Vegetarian beer????

Dietary restrictions: Dietary beer??? Oh yeah, Miller lite, Bud light and Coors light.

Kid-friendliness: It's a bar. Probably not but if you did, they would be friendly.

Wheelchair accessibility: Absolutely, use the back door right off of the parking lot.

Audrey Lewis

Great little hole in the wall bar. Only serves beer. Would be really nice if they got the air cleaner working. It is hard to handle all the cigarette smoke, but with a lack of places to choose from, we deal with it. They have a dart board and a pool table.
